Walkers news: Sept. 16 -- St. Louis 5, Cedar Rapids 2

Record: 86-59, 1st, 5.5 GA Springfield
Alex Faedo took a shutout into the eighth inning and St. Louis took control early with a four-run bottom of the first inning as it downed Cedar Rapids 5-2 at Busch Stadium (1997).
Bo Bichette led off the bottom of the first with a single off Golden Grapplers starting pitcher Carlos Martinez.
Bichette moved to second when Carlos Vidal ended up reaching on a sacrifice bunt attempt.
Rhys Hoskins walked to load the bases.
Andrew Benintendi drove in Bichette with a sacrifice fly.
After a strike out, Jean Carmona launched a three-run homer, putting the River Walkers up 4-0.
St. Louis added another run in the fifth.
Bichette singled off Martinez and scored on a Hoskins single.
After seven shutout innings, Faedo ran into trouble in the eighth allowing back-to-back one-out solo homers to Domingo Santana and Jean Carlos Arias.
Tim Hill took over for Faedo and didn't suffer any other major damage.
The ninth belonged to Jake Brentz, who set the Golden Grapplers down in order for his 16th save.
For the game, Faedo worked 7.1 innings allowing the two runs on six hits. He struck out five and walked none.
